This film had a great cast and a lot of potential in all the characters but they seemed to fade away after the interval. The story was a great one under the circumstances of British Empire, but I feel they couldn't do justice to it.

The character of Master da should have been more detailed and the first female martyr of the 20th century Preetilota Waddedar's character should have gotten a little more focus. History remembers her greatness as she was. The director tried his best for the first hour but then it started to weaken as it went to the end. There was a lot of expectations at the start after seeing the legendary actors of Indian cinema in the film but they failed to meet the expectations. But, nonetheless a good effort to witness.
